In 1974, Masek and colleagues released a sequence of placebo-controlled double-blind trials analyzing the usage of PEA for a respiratory an infection prophylactic inside a population of 1386 volunteers and described an important reduction in ache, volume of fever episodes, and incidence of respiratory tract infections [9]. Impulsin was withdrawn from the market many years afterwards for no clear explanation. However, oral PEA formulations proceed to be readily available as more than-the-counter dietary health supplements to today.

From the nineteen sixties, PEA was initially marketed for prophylactic procedure of influenza and the prevalent cold. Study fascination elevated within the nineteen seventies, with 6 clinical trials confirming the efficiency of PEA on influenza symptoms and incidence.
